Cheers ruby - I appreciate it when anyone takes the time to read my ramblings
Of the 3 car related things that are due in the next couple of months (tax, insurance & breakdown) I've just bought my breakdown cover - AA for £74 for the policy I want and hopefully £42 cashback to get from that. I switch between AA & RAC each year to get new customer/online/cashback deals.
Also going on holiday on Friday for a week with the family... whatever's left of the money I've saved for spending will go towards the debts.

Thanks tootallulah - I'll definitely be slowing down as now I've earned so much via the freelance work to start paying class 4 NICS as well. I already pay 40% tax on ALL of it, don't really want to pay another 9% as well... not worth it! Will put the time back into the family and make up the time lost
Well, all of my yearly car payments have now been sorted. Got a very good price for my insurance and put it on a 0% purchases card instead of paying it monthly at 20% or whatever ridiculous APR they charge.
Looking forward to next payday as I should be under the £2k milestone. Ideally I'd like to have paid off 90%, but that would require only £1,657 to be left which is a bit of a stretch.
